Wantek Cisco Phone Headset for Landline Office Phone,Noise Canceling Microphone and Mute Switch
Quick take
This Wantek headset is designed for office desk phones that use compatible Cisco IP phone models and an RJ9 headset connection. Reviews highlight clear call audio, useful inline controls (volume and mute), and a comfortable setup for longer work sessions. The biggest buying caveat is making sure your exact Cisco model and connector type match the supported list.

What buyers think
Buyer-review evidence is generally consistent on everyday performance. Multiple reviews describe the headset working as intended with desk phones, including Cisco setups, and delivering audio that others can hear clearly. Users also mention the inline controls as a convenient day-to-day feature, and several note comfort benefits compared with holding a phone to the shoulder. One recurring theme is that included adapter pieces can be confusing if you are expecting the “main” connector to be the only option, and there are a few fit-adjacent notes about a headset component that can catch hair during removal.
Overall, the review pattern points to solid voice clarity for office calls and easy usability, with the main practical risk being whether your exact Cisco model is supported.

Design and key features that matter
RJ9 headset connection for specific Cisco IP models
The headset is built around a standard RJ9-style connection approach, but compatibility is intentionally narrow. Before buying, confirm your Cisco IP phone model appears on the supported list to avoid purchasing an audio headset that will not integrate properly.
Noise-canceling microphone plus mute switch
The microphone is designed to capture your voice with noise reduction capabilities, which is especially useful in busy office environments. The inline mute switch gives you a fast way to silence your mic without taking your hands off your work.
Inline volume control for desk workflow
The headset includes in-line controls that let you adjust volume and manage the microphone. This is helpful if you often toggle between internal calls and louder office surroundings.
Comfort for longer calls
Buyers commonly describe an adjustable, comfortable fit for extended office sessions, with the main cautions being minor fit-hardware quirks for removal and personal hair style.

FAQ
- What Cisco phone models is this headset compatible with? It is compatible only with specific Cisco IP phone models listed by the manufacturer. Verify your exact model number before purchasing.
- Does it work with cell phones or computers? No, this headset is designed for supported office desk phones, not for cell phones and computers.
- Does it include a microphone mute? Yes, it has an inline mute switch along with volume control.
- How is the microphone quality for office use? Buyer feedback indicates callers can hear the user clearly, and the microphone is designed with noise-reduction capabilities to help in busier environments.
- Is it comfortable for long calls? Reviews generally describe a comfortable, adjustable fit for longer sessions, with a minor note that one headset component can catch hair during removal.
